Get Access To All JobsTips for Finding E-3 Visa Sponsorship as a Network Operations Engineer
Translate your CCNA or CCNP credentials
U.S. employers read Cisco certifications alongside your degree when assessing specialty occupation eligibility. Pair your transcript with a credential evaluation that maps your Australian qualification to a U.S. bachelor's equivalent before applying.
Target employers with active LCA filing history
Companies that have filed Labor Condition Applications for network or infrastructure roles already understand E-3 visa mechanics. Search DOL's OFLC disclosure data to filter for employers who have sponsored network engineers in the past two years.
Clarify the job description before the offer
The E-3 requires a direct tie between the role and a specific degree field. If a job posting says 'related degree preferred,' push the hiring manager to specify required qualifications in the offer letter so the LCA reflects a true specialty occupation.

Confirm your start date accounts for LCA processing
DOL typically certifies an LCA within seven business days, but your employer still needs time to prepare supporting documents. Negotiate a start date at least three weeks out from your offer acceptance to avoid pressure on the consulate appointment timeline.
Address contract and consulting roles upfront
Network operations roles are sometimes structured as contractor positions through a staffing firm. For E-3 purposes, the entity signing the LCA must be your actual day-to-day employer, not just a placement agency, so clarify the employment structure before filing.

Does a Network Operations Engineer role qualify as a specialty occupation for the E-3?
Yes, provided the role requires at least a bachelor's degree in a directly related field such as computer science, information technology, or electrical engineering. Roles that accept any degree regardless of field, or that substitute extensive experience for a degree without a formal requirement, can face scrutiny at the consulate. Your offer letter and job description need to specify the degree requirement clearly.
How does the E-3 compare to the H-1B for Network Operations Engineers?
The E-3 has a 10,500-annual allocation that has never been exhausted, so there's no lottery and no random selection risk. The H-1B is capped at 85,000 per year and oversubscribed, meaning most applicants don't get selected. For Australian network engineers, the E-3 is a direct path to a U.S. role without the uncertainty that makes H-1B sponsorship a gamble for both candidate and employer.
Can I change employers or roles while on an E-3?
Yes, but each new position requires a fresh LCA filed by the new employer and a new visa stamp if your current stamp has expired. You can begin working for the new employer once the LCA is certified and, if you're already in the U.S. in valid E-3 status, without waiting for a new visa stamp. A role change within the same company may also require an amended LCA if the job duties shift materially.
